Daftar Isi:

Cermin Ajaib Mini untuk Di Bawah $60 USD: 5 Langkah (dengan Gambar)
Cermin Ajaib Mini untuk Di Bawah $60 USD: 5 Langkah (dengan Gambar)

Video: Cermin Ajaib Mini untuk Di Bawah $60 USD: 5 Langkah (dengan Gambar)

Video: Cermin Ajaib Mini untuk Di Bawah $60 USD: 5 Langkah (dengan Gambar)
Video: NAIK LAMBORGHINI TAPI BAYAR PARKIR 2 RIBU BIKIN MALU 2024, November
Anonim
Image
Image
Cermin Ajaib Mini dengan Harga Di Bawah $60 USD
Cermin Ajaib Mini dengan Harga Di Bawah $60 USD

'Magic MIrror' adalah proyek di mana cermin 2 arah ditempatkan di atas layar. Di mana layar menunjukkan piksel hitam, cerminnya reflektif. Di mana layar menunjukkan piksel putih atau lebih terang, mereka bersinar. Ini menciptakan efek dapat menampilkan teks digital, ikon, atau bahkan gambar melalui cermin, sambil tetap mempertahankan reflektifitas. Gambar ketiga di atas harus menunjukkan seperti apa bentuknya.

Video youtube menunjukkan perakitan ujung ke ujung, dan memiliki demo di bagian akhir yang menunjukkan seperti apa proyek yang sudah selesai. Saya ingin meluangkan waktu untuk menuliskan langkah-langkahnya di sini, karena saya menikmati komunitas yang dapat diajar, dan saya ingin tempat untuk membuat catatan tentang hal-hal seperti konfigurasi perangkat lunak, dan menjawab pertanyaan.

Saya telah melihat banyak proyek cermin ajaib dan selalu ingin membuatnya. Saya mulai membangunnya baru-baru ini sebagai hadiah, dan tidak tahu berapa biaya porsi cermin 2 arah! Setelah menghabiskan $75,00 (USD) untuk cermin saja, saya menyadari bahwa proyek ini akan berjalan dengan baik dari 'anggaran hadiah teman' kami dan saya harus memikirkan kembali strategi saya. Setelah menemukan saluran N-O-D-E di youtube, ia memiliki konsep kotak piramida kecil. Saya segera mulai menjalankan konsep itu, bereksperimen dengan raspberry pi apa yang dapat saya muat, cara membuat casing dengan mudah, dan cara menjalankan perangkat lunak.

Pada akhirnya saya memilih untuk mencetak kasing 3D. Saya merancang kasing di tinkercad. Ini adalah dua bagian sederhana yang mudah disatukan. Cermin adalah cermin 4,5" yang hanya direkatkan (lem pistol) ke bingkai. Komputer utama adalah Raspberry pi zero dengan kartu micro SD 8 Gig, dan layarnya adalah layar 3,5" dari Kuman yang memiliki port HDMI sudah di atasnya. Sejujurnya 75% dari proyek ini adalah desain tinkercad untuk kasing, dan mencari tahu layar yang sesuai, dapat dengan mudah dinyalakan dari satu kabel USB, dan menyesuaikan perangkat lunak.

Inilah biaya suku cadang untuk memberi Anda ikhtisar. Ini di bawah 60 dolar jika Anda memiliki printer 3D … jika tidak, Anda akan ingin menyewa cetakan 3D, atau mungkin membangun bingkai piramida kayu (saya HAMPIR pergi rute itu, dan mungkin di masa depan dapat diinstruksikan, karena saya pikir noda kasing kayu ek bisa terlihat sangat keren untuk ini:))

Raspberry pi Zero W - $10.00 - Adafruit.com - Batasi satu per pesanan

Kartu Micro SD 8Gig - $4,00 - Amazon.com

Layar TFT Kuman 3.5 - $29.99 - Amazon.com - Versi HDMI

Kabel USB SN-Riggor (Opsional, tetapi menambahkan beberapa bakat) - 4 untuk 16.00 ($4.00 masing-masing) Amazon.com

Cermin 2 Arah - Persegi 115mm - $5,00 dari Tap Plastics (Saya membawa kotak cetak 3D ke toko dan meminta mereka memotongnya agar sesuai)

Filamen 3D - Bernilai sekitar 2 dolar

Mini-HDMI -> Adaptor HDMI - 2 seharga $6,00 (Hanya perlu satu): Amazon.com

Pada akhirnya saya sudah memiliki beberapa adaptor, tetapi Anda seharusnya bisa mendapatkannya dengan harga di atas atau lebih baik, dan pada akhirnya di bawah $60,00. Karena ini tentang berapa banyak yang akan kami keluarkan jika kami saling membelikan game Xbox atau PS4, ini sesuai dengan 'anggaran teman' kami.

Ok, cukup intronya, yuk kita pelajari cara membuatnya!

Langkah 1: Langkah 1 - Pasang Bagian Hitung

Langkah 1 - Pasang Bagian Hitung
Langkah 1 - Pasang Bagian Hitung
Langkah 1 - Pasang Bagian Hitung
Langkah 1 - Pasang Bagian Hitung
Langkah 1 - Pasang Bagian Hitung
Langkah 1 - Pasang Bagian Hitung
Langkah 1 - Pasang Bagian Hitung
Langkah 1 - Pasang Bagian Hitung

Gambar pertama menunjukkan semua bagian yang ditata. Yang kedua menunjukkan perakitan porsi komputasi yang sedang berlangsung. Tidak banyak keajaiban pada saat ini … inilah langkah-langkahnya:

  1. Pastikan Anda TIDAK menyolder header ke pi nol. Anda akan membutuhkan semua ruang yang bisa Anda dapatkan!
  2. Tempatkan port Mini HDMI ke HDMI di Pi Zero
  3. Tempatkan adaptor HDMI->HDMI yang disertakan dengan layar Kuman ke dalam Slot HDMI
  4. Tempatkan layar Kuman ke bagian lain dari adaptor HDMI..ini harus sesuai dengan port HDMI perempuan di layar Kuman
  5. Tempatkan kabel USB melalui bagian belakang piramida
  6. Saya telah membubuhi keterangan gambar dengan kabel listrik, dan menambahkan pinout pi. Langkah ini sangat penting, tetapi jauh lebih mudah daripada yang terlihat… Anda akan ingin menjalankan dua kabel kecil dari pin pertama dan ketiga pada Pi ke layar. Jika Anda menggunakan kabel jumper, Anda dapat mencolokkannya ke bagian belakang layar, lalu menekuknya di sekitar pin pada pi dan merekatkannya dengan panas. Idealnya ini harus disolder pada pi, dan direkatkan panas untuk menahannya ke dalam layar. Ini melewatkan 5 volt dari pi ke layar, dan merupakan salah satu trik untuk menjaga proyek ini tetap bersih dan rapi…setelah ini selesai, satu kabel memberi daya pada pi dan layar secukupnya!

Pada titik ini Anda sudah hampir setengah jalan dengan perakitan. Sebelum menutupnya, mari kita menulis gambar perangkat lunak pada langkah berikutnya.

Langkah 2: Menyiapkan Perangkat Lunak

Ada banyak sekali tutorial tentang cara menulis gambar Kartu SD untuk raspberry pi ke kartu microSD, dan saya tidak ingin mengulanginya. Tetapi penting, karena ini adalah Pi Zero W yang kami gunakan, untuk mengetahui beberapa trik untuk menjalankannya. Pertama, silahkan kunjungi situs Emmanuels di:

emmanuelcontreras.com/how-to/how-to-create-…

Dia telah melakukan pekerjaan untuk mendokumentasikan dan membuat gambar dari perangkat lunak Cermin Ajaib ke Raspberry pi nol (seperti yang Anda lihat dari langkahnya, ini bisa sangat sulit). Gulir ke bawah dan Anda akan melihat, di bagian bawah setelah langkahnya, gambar siap pakai yang dapat Anda gunakan. (Jika Anda mencari 'File gambar', itu akan membawa Anda ke sana).

Selanjutnya, Anda ingin mengikuti langkah-langkah yang telah dia daftarkan untuk menghubungkan ke wifi dan menambahkan ssh. Satu tip yang SANGAT penting di sini: JANGAN gunakan Notepad di windows untuk mengedit file supplicant_conf. Notepad akan memotong akhir baris agar tidak kompatibel dengan Linux, dan Anda tidak akan terhubung. Notepad ++ adalah pengganti gratis untuk notepad dan dapat melakukan akhiran baris yang tepat.

Ketika Anda telah menulis gambar itu (saya menggunakan disk imager Win32 di windows) dan mengedit file supplicant_conf dan menambahkan SSH, Anda akan siap untuk memasukkan kartu dan mem-boot perangkat.

Pada titik ini Pi harus terhubung ke wifi Anda. Triknya kemudian adalah menemukannya:) Ada sejumlah aplikasi pemindaian ip di luar sana untuk ponsel dan PC. Pemindai IP Tingkat Lanjut akan berfungsi untuk windows. Untuk iPhone, saya menggunakan iNet di iPhone saya untuk memindai pi nol. Ketika Anda menemukannya, Anda dapat menggunakan aplikasi telnet seperti Putty untuk menghubungkannya melalui SSH. Ini penting untuk mengonfigurasi Perangkat Lunak MagicMirror dan menginstal add-on!

Setelah Anda sampai sejauh ini, sambungkan microUSB ke daya, dan pastikan Anda dapat boot dan terhubung melalui SSH. Pada saat itu Anda akan siap untuk melanjutkan dan mengancingkan kasing.

Langkah 3: Menyelesaikan Perakitan - Memasang Layar di Bingkai dan Menambahkan Cermin

Perakitan Penyelesaian - Memasang Layar di Bingkai dan Menambahkan Cermin
Perakitan Penyelesaian - Memasang Layar di Bingkai dan Menambahkan Cermin
Perakitan Penyelesaian - Memasang Layar di Bingkai dan Menambahkan Cermin
Perakitan Penyelesaian - Memasang Layar di Bingkai dan Menambahkan Cermin
Perakitan Penyelesaian - Memasang Layar di Bingkai dan Menambahkan Cermin
Perakitan Penyelesaian - Memasang Layar di Bingkai dan Menambahkan Cermin
Perakitan Penyelesaian - Memasang Layar di Bingkai dan Menambahkan Cermin
Perakitan Penyelesaian - Memasang Layar di Bingkai dan Menambahkan Cermin

Pastikan layar melakukan booting dan menyala saat Anda mencolokkan daya ke Pi. Waktu boot adalah 3-5 menit, jadi harap bersabar..itu harus mem-boot pi, lalu meluncurkan browser, dan kemudian meluncurkan perangkat lunak cermin ajaib. Untungnya Anda tidak boleh sering-sering mem-boot/mematikan ini (biayanya kurang dari 7 sen setahun untuk menjalankannya dengan penarikan daya sekitar 100mA). Selanjutnya kita akan menyelesaikan perakitan:

  1. Layar dihubungkan ke bagian belakang Bingkai yang dicetak 3D. Silakan gunakan gambar sebagai panduan.. 'depan' adalah bagian datar, bagian belakang memiliki colokan dan barang-barang yang keluar. Masukkan layar dari belakang.
  2. Saat layar terpasang dengan pas, letakkan karet gelang di sekitar pasak dan di atas layar untuk menahannya di tempatnya. Ini adalah cara paling sederhana yang bisa saya lakukan untuk menahan layar, dan itu bekerja dengan baik. Ini juga bagus karena seluruh proyek terpisah dengan mulus jika diperlukan dengan pendekatan ini!
  3. Masukkan kabel daya ke Pi. Anda tidak akan dapat melakukan ini setelah dirakit, jadi inilah saatnya untuk menyalakan!
  4. Tekan dudukan bingkai cetak 3D ke dalam piramida..tab di bagian luar akan menahannya agar tidak tenggelam, dan harus terpasang dengan pas di tempatnya.
  5. Sebelum menambahkan cermin, gunakan selotip hitam di sekitar bagian di mana layar bertemu dengan cetakan 3D. Ini agar tidak ada kebocoran ringan…Saya mencoba membuat bingkai sekencang mungkin, tetapi langkah sederhana ini akan memastikannya tetap bersih. Tutupi perak layar juga, sehingga tidak ada cahaya yang dipantulkan dari cermin dan merusak efeknya
  6. Lem panas di atas selotip yang baru saja Anda pasang, dan tekan cermin. (Catatan: Bingkai/layar semua harus dirakit pada saat ini, jadi menempatkan cermin pada seharusnya memungkinkan Anda untuk menyelaraskannya dengan sudut piramida dan semuanya berbaris dengan baik). Jangan menggunakan terlalu banyak lem atau lem akan terlihat.. manik-manik ringan sudah cukup. Cermin itu tidak terlalu berat.

Anda harus mulai bersemangat sekarang, karena Anda harus mulai melihat hasil kerja Anda… waktu atau tanggal harus terlihat melalui cermin. Selanjutnya adalah konfigurasi!

Langkah 4: Perakitan dan Konfigurasi Akhir

Perakitan dan Konfigurasi Akhir
Perakitan dan Konfigurasi Akhir
Perakitan dan Konfigurasi Akhir
Perakitan dan Konfigurasi Akhir
Perakitan dan Konfigurasi Akhir
Perakitan dan Konfigurasi Akhir

Pada titik ini Anda pada dasarnya telah dirakit dan harus menjalankan perangkat lunak dan dapat masuk SSH. Namun modul mungkin berantakan, dan Anda bertanya-tanya bagaimana cara memperbaikinya.

Pertama, Anda akan ingin membaca sedikit tentang cara kerja perangkat lunak Magic MIrror. Itu dapat ditemukan di sini:

magicmirror.builders/

Ini tidak akan menjadi instruksi yang baik meskipun tanpa memberi Anda quickstart/cheat sheet untuk memulai. Berikut beberapa tips dan penjelasan tentang cara kerjanya:

  • Modul Cermin Ajaib hanya git dikloning dari repositori modul ke dalam folder modul. Jadi ketika Anda masuk SSH, cd ke direktori MagicMirror (ingat di direktori Linux peka huruf besar-kecil). Kemudian cd ke modul. Kemudian Anda dapat git mengkloning salah satu add-on ke dalam folder itu.
  • Daftar modul ada di sini:

    github.com/MichMich/MagicMirror/wiki/3rd-p… Masing-masing harus memiliki instruksi untuk mengonfigurasinya.

  • satu Modul yang segera Anda inginkan adalah MMM-Carousel. Modul ini menggilir semua modul lain yang diinstal. (https://github.com/barnabycolby/MMM-Carousel)
  • Untuk mengkonfigurasi semuanya, Anda harus pergi ke folder MagicMirror/config, dan mengedit file config.js
  • Di Config.js, Anda ingin menambahkan nama modul yang telah Anda tambahkan melalui klon Git di atas. Anda akan ingin memposisikannya (saya memposisikan semua milik saya ke: middle_center. Kemudian korsel akan menampilkan satu per satu, dan beralih di antara mereka. Itu terjadi setelah jumlah detik yang dapat dikonfigurasi (saya menggunakan 45 detik untuk milik saya)
  • Perhatikan bahwa Anda ingin mengubah ukuran font. Terkadang Anda dapat melakukan ini di config.js, tetapi yang lain Anda harus menemukan file.css yang disertakan dengan modul, mencari sesuatu yang diakhiri dengan.px, dan mengubah nilainya menjadi ukuran font yang lebih besar. Saya menemukan bahwa ini bervariasi berdasarkan modul.

Saya menemukan bahwa modul waktu/tanggal, cuaca, stok, dan lalu lintas bekerja sangat baik dengan proyek ini. Modul media seperti-g.webp

Selanjutnya adalah pemikiran akhir dan rencana masa depan …

Langkah 5: Pikiran Terakhir - Apa yang Akan Saya Lakukan Berbeda dan Apa yang Saya Suka

Pikiran Terakhir - Apa yang Akan Saya Lakukan Berbeda dan Apa yang Saya Suka
Pikiran Terakhir - Apa yang Akan Saya Lakukan Berbeda dan Apa yang Saya Suka

Proyek ini sangat menyenangkan. Butuh banyak waktu untuk mengedit file konfigurasi, pencetakan 3D, dan pekerjaan desain untuk menyelesaikan kasusnya. Tetapi pada akhirnya, itu datang bersama dengan baik, saya pikir dan istri saya menikmati cermin (saya membuat cermin pertama untuk seorang teman dan dia segera menginginkannya juga!). Saya mungkin akan membuat satu lagi, dan mengubah beberapa hal karena alasan gaya, dan beberapa karena alasan kinerja:

  • Saya akan menambahkan tombol ke atas. Tampilan piramida SANGAT bersih dan futuristik, namun tidak memungkinkan kontrol cermin yang cepat. Saya pikir tombol sederhana untuk mengubah secara manual dari satu layar ke layar berikutnya daripada menunggu akan berguna
  • Saya akan mencoba menambahkan pengeras suara - Saya pikir memiliki aliran musik ini akan sangat keren…atau memutar suara peringatan
  • Saya mungkin mencoba membuatnya dari kayu - Meskipun cetakan 3D sangat mudah untuk direplikasi dan dibuat, saya pikir tampilan kayu ek atau kayu bernoda akan sangat keren
  • Pindah ke Pi3A+ - A+ tidak keluar ketika saya membangun ini, jadi saya jatuh kembali ke pizero. A+ menambahkan 15 dolar ke harga (tetapi memiliki HDMI ukuran penuh, jadi mungkin hanya menambahkan sekitar 12,50), tetapi menambahkan satu ton daya. Juga browser tidak dipercepat GPU dalam build ini, dan A+ akan…jadi saya pikir peningkatan daya akan berguna.
  • Cermin yang dapat dilepas - Saya pikir cermin yang dapat dilepas akan berguna, karena beberapa media seperti youtube tidak bagus untuk dilihat melalui cermin. Juga ini bisa menjadi sistem permainan kasual keren dengan layar berputar (putar saja piramida dan letakkan di sisi yang berbeda) jika dibangun secara berbeda.
  • Tambahkan mikrofon - Saya dapat mengintegrasikan Alexa dan menjadikannya asisten pintar, atau pengontrol suara, jika saya menambahkan mikrofon kecil.

Pada akhirnya, ada sesuatu tentang kesederhanaan dan menjadi murah. Proyek ini hanya untuk saya, dan merakit yang kedua untuk istri saya membutuhkan waktu kurang dari 15 menit (di luar 9 jam waktu printer 3D:)).

Jika Anda membangunnya, beri tahu saya, dan jika Anda memiliki pertanyaan, silakan tinggalkan di bawah atau di saluran youtube dan saya akan berusaha menjawabnya. Video youtube memiliki demo cermin di awal dan akhir … sulit untuk menggambarkannya dalam gambar. Itu terlihat sangat bersih di sebelah komputer, di meja kamar mandi, atau di meja samping tempat tidur. Juga mungkin ada lebih dari 100 modul yang tersedia… mulai dari statistik komputer hingga harga bitcoin. Ini benar-benar dapat menjadi tampilan data yang sangat buruk, dan karena memiliki komputer di dalamnya, ia berjalan terpisah dari hal lain (baik kecuali wifi:))

Terima kasih telah membaca dan harap Anda menikmati bangunan ini!

Direkomendasikan: